Osseointegration and biomechanical properties of the onplant system
American Journal of Orthodontics and Dentofacial Orthopedics, 09/20/07
Chen, X., et al. - Conclusions: These results suggest that osseointegration occurred mainly after the 4-week healing period. The shear force of onplants increased with healing time, suggesting that shear force is not necessarily determined by the area of newly formed bone, but to a certain degree depends also on the density of the newly formed bone. The notion of loading onplants for orthodontic tooth movement as early as possible needs further clinical study for verification
